bpf: Simplify bpf_timer_cancel()
Remove lock from the bpf_timer_cancel() helper. The lock does not
protect from concurrent modification of the bpf_async_cb data fields as
those are modified in the callback without locking.
Use guard(rcu)() instead of pair of explicit lock()/unlock().
